Correia Wins Second Term as Mayor of Fall River
Wednesday, November 08, 2017
Jasiel Correia, II won a second term as Mayor of Fall River garnering over 60 percent of the vote and beating back Councilwoman Linda Pereira.
Correia is the Commonwealth’s youngest Mayor and will not turn 26-years-of-age until December.

One of the keys to his re-election was successfully landing the nearly 2,000 job Amazon distribution facility.
